Transaction 7d63b84e12ff15b0cf09d7eac961f8b14a98ad0fd9cf83add970621fb06f8144
1 Input
2 Outputs
- 7d63b84e12ff15b0cf09d7eac961f8b14a98ad0fd9cf83add970621fb06f8144:0
- 7d63b84e12ff15b0cf09d7eac961f8b14a98ad0fd9cf83add970621fb06f8144:1
value 200000000
address n23jcrx5HFK2Gg5ZD38FKtbktHyMNFfRo9
value 1059396040
address mvJJfq6vapc1g6RmVkktXqqzA7grnp8SwF